G.E.H.A (Government Employees Health Association, Inc.) is a nonprofit member association that provides medical and dental benefits to more than two million federal employees and retirees, military retirees and their families. We celebrate diversity and are committed to creating an inclusive environment for all employees.

G.E.H.A has one mission: To empower federal workers to be healthy and well.

Offering one of the largest medical and dental benefit provider networks available to federal employees in the United States, G.E.H.A empowers health and wellness by meeting its members where they are, when they need care. We serve our members with products they value and a personalized customer experience, sustained by a nimble and efficient organization.

Work‑at‑home Requirements
  • Must have the ability to provide a non‑cellular High Speed Internet Service such as Fiber, DSL, or cable Modems for a home office.
  • A minimum standard speed for optimal performance of 30x5 (30 Mbps download x 5 Mbps upload) is required.
  • Latency (ping) response time lower than 80 ms.
  • Hotspots, satellite and wireless internet service is NOT allowed for this role.
  • A dedicated space lacking ongoing interruptions to protect member PHI / HIPAA information.
